Guix,

Inappropriate images and links have been posted today to our mailing
lists under subject “[Guix Logo]: New Design” (also as bug #43472) and
“[IceCat]: IMPORTANT!”; those images were also posted on IRC.

This message is to warn you and to summarize how this happened and
measures we’ve taken; you do not need to reply.


The first time someone posts, they’re put under moderation; a list admin
must clear their moderation bit and subsequent messages go to the list.
The person who sent these messages had first sent a legitimate question,
which is why those other messages reached the list.

We do not tolerate this behavior, which violates our code of conduct:

  https://git.savannah.gnu.org/cgit/guix.git/tree/CODE-OF-CONDUCT

Leo Famulari and the maintainers who were present at the time banned
that person from our IRC channel and mailing lists minutes after that
happened.  We’ve also asked the FSF staff in charge of GNU mailing
lists to remove those messages from the archives, though that hasn’t
materialized yet.  We’re still discussing other ways we can avoid that
in the future.

We welcome suggestions and feedback to guix-maintainers@gnu.org, a
private alias that reaches the five co-maintainers.


It is our goal as maintainers to make this space friendly and inclusive
to all those who want to participate.  This event reminds us that
achieving this goal is a relentless effort.
